## Local Setup

PixHoard's thumbnail cache leaks memory under sustained load, so we reproduce it locally before every fix. Install the profiler extras, start the cache worker, and replay the sample traffic bundle. The worker needs the metadata database running first; configure it with the connection string below.

primary connection of yagep-kahip = redis://giliel_svc:zYiKsLL2PLpfPL@db-348f.xolmarsys.corp:5432/fenwyn

// Circuit breaker config for the Drossel upstream API.
// Plugin authors: do not change the trip threshold (5 failures / 30s)
// or the half-open probe interval. The breaker protects the shared
// Harfen quota pool; a tripped breaker means back off, not retry harder.
// Fallback responses come from the Quillet cache and may be stale.
// The client below authenticates to the internal Harfen gateway
// with the key on the next line.

service key, fawip-bajef: kto11_Qt5wZK9vdNC

## Onboarding: Password reset revamp (Project Latchkey)

The Latchkey revamp replaces emailed reset links with short-lived codes verified by the Hollowgate service. Flows live in `apps/latchkey/reset/`; templates are in `notices/`. Local development runs against a Hollowgate sandbox, which rate-limits to 20 requests per minute — enough for manual testing. The sandbox requires a signing credential in your local `.env` before any reset code will validate. Add this line to it.

env line for fafof-fahag: LEDGER_TOKEN5=f8790

Subject: On-call notes — Keelhaven bloom filter

Hi, welcome to the rotation. Quick context before your first shift: the Keelhaven key-value store sits behind a bloom filter that screens lookups for keys we know don't exist. If the filter's false-positive rate climbs, read latency on the backing store spikes and you'll get paged. Usual causes are a stale filter rebuild or a bulk-load that skipped the filter refresh job. The rebuild procedure and the relevant dashboards are documented on the internal page below.

operations page: https://jenkins.zemvarcloud.local/job/merge_requests/repo/build/73930b4b30f0a8ed